Job summary
A leading life sciences firm in Santa Clara is seeking a Principal Mechanical Engineer to innovate and develop advanced systems for DNA sequencing. The selected candidate will lead projects in mechanical design and manage cross-functional teams. Ideal candidates will have a PhD in Mechanical or Bioengineering, with extensive experience in complex system design, 3D CAD proficiency, and a solid foundation in fluidics. The position emphasizes a hands-on approach and offers a unique opportunity to contribute to next-generation sequencing technology in a dynamic environment.
